A graduate of Emory University School of Law, Janet began her legal career in Atlanta, Georgia, where she practiced with Atlanta Legal Services Agency.

After moving to Boston in 1969, Janet began practicing law with Jerome Lyle Rappaport a partnership that continued until his death in 2021.  Janet served as the general counsel to New Boston Fund from its founding in 1983, until 2018 representing it and all its property-owning entities in all aspects of commercial real estate law. She also served as counsel to Charles River Park.

Janet is a graduate of Mount Holyoke College, magna cum laude, where she served on the Mount Holyoke College Board of Trustees from 2006-2011.

She is a long-time member of the Massachusetts Bar Foundation (MBF) and has served on its Board from 2010 to 2018 and as its President from 2016 to 2018. In 2009, she received the MBF President’s Award.

Janet was a member of the Massachusetts IOLTA Committee from 2016 through 2019. She also served on the Board of The Rashi School for 14 years, chairing its Building Committee during the design, financing and construction of its current facility, which opened in Dedham in 2010.

Janet is a founding member of the Miriam Fund, a philanthropic community committed to creating an equitable world that expands opportunities for women and girls, and now sits on its Executive Committee.
